Publication
Their Eyes Were Watching God (1937 Lippincott edition) was released on 1937[7]. Place of publication include Philadelphia[4] and London[5]. Their Eyes Were Watching God (1937 Lippincott edition)'s language of work or name is recorded as English[6].
